2. _The body electrical._ By this, I mean that which has commonly been
termed "nervous influence," "nervous fluid," "nervo-vital fluid," and
"nervo-electric fluid." I object, however, to each and all of these
designations. They are too restricted and specific. They all seem to
imply that it is an agent or influence which appertains especially to
the _nervous_ system; whereas the entire organism is under its pervading
force. I do not doubt but its chief action is in and through the nervous
system; but it also pervades and, as I think, vitalizes the whole body.
The nervous system seems to be created as one principal means for its
replenishment,[A] and to serve as the medium of its ministrations to the
body at large. I choose to term it _electro-vital fluid_, or
_electro-vitality_. My reasons for so designating it are the following:
(1) It is demonstrably electrical in its nature. (2) It appears to be
identified, or at least connected immediately, with the vitalization of
the body. (3) I wish, by its name, to distinguish it from _mental_
vitality, or the vitality of _spirit_. Whether, as a peculiar
manifestation of the electric principle, it vitalizes by its own nature
and action solely, or whether it be _charged_ with another mysterious
element--a _life-force_--and vitalizes by ministering the latter to the
material organism, I will not positively affirm. Whichever it be, the
name I assign to it seems sufficiently appropriate. But I strongly
incline to the theory that this electro-vital principle does itself, by
virtue of its own nature, vitalize the system. In other words, I am
disposed to think that God makes it the _immediate_ agent of
vitalization; having constituted it the _vis vitæ_ of both the animal
and the vegetable kingdoms. Nor does this idea, as I conceive,
necessarily conflict at all with the doctrine of _cell-life_, as
maintained by the best physiologists of the present day. I also
sometimes style this electro-vital element the _body electrical_,
because it is certainly an entity, coëxtensive with and, in greater or
less force, wholly pervading the visible, material body.
At this point I will take the liberty to introduce, although somewhat
digressively, a few thoughts on the DISTINCTIONS OF VITALITY OR LIFE.
There are, as I suppose, the following several kinds of life: (1)
_Spirit life_; (2) _Moral life_; (3) _Electric life_.
(1.) There is _spirit_ life. And here are to be made several
subdivisions.
[1.] _Uncreated_ spirit life. This is the life of God. Of the nature of
the Divine Essence we know nothing; yet that God is a real, living
entity, we do know. My own conviction is that the divine essence and the
divine life are identical; that God, a spirit, is necessary, infinite,
conscious VITALITY--the voluntary Originator of all existencies besides
himself. But as to what is the essential nature of this vitality--this
eternal spirit-life--we can have no conception, only that this life is
God.
